1 Reply Latest reply on Mar 14, 2012 3:00 AM by Daniel Jipa

    Hibernate Issue

    Phanor Coll Newbie

      Im trying to use Hibernate 4.1 but i get this error when trying to insert:

      Im I missing something?

       

       

      Mar 13, 2012 11:27:54 PM org.hibernate.annotations.common.Version <clinit>

      INFO: HCANN000001: Hibernate Commons Annotations {4.0.1.Final}

      Mar 13, 2012 11:27:54 PM org.hibernate.Version logVersion

      INFO: HHH000412: Hibernate Core {4.1.1}

      Mar 13, 2012 11:27:54 PM org.hibernate.cfg.Environment <clinit>

      INFO: HHH000206: hibernate.properties not found

      Mar 13, 2012 11:27:54 PM org.hibernate.cfg.Environment buildBytecodeProvider

      INFO: HHH000021: Bytecode provider name : javassist

      Mar 13, 2012 11:27:54 PM org.hibernate.cfg.Configuration configure

      INFO: HHH000043: Configuring from resource: /hibernate.cfg.xml

      Mar 13, 2012 11:27:54 PM org.hibernate.cfg.Configuration getConfigurationInputStream

      INFO: HHH000040: Configuration resource: /hibernate.cfg.xml

      Mar 13, 2012 11:27:54 PM org.hibernate.internal.util.xml.DTDEntityResolver resolveEntity

      WARN: HHH000223: Recognized obsolete hibernate namespace http://hibernate.sourceforge.net/. Use namespace http://www.hibernate.org/dtd/ instead. Refer to Hibernate 3.6 Migration Guide!

      Mar 13, 2012 11:27:54 PM org.hibernate.cfg.Configuration doConfigure

      INFO: HHH000041: Configured SessionFactory: null

      Mar 13, 2012 11:27:54 PM org.hibernate.service.jdbc.connections.internal.DriverManagerConnectionProviderImpl configure

      INFO: HHH000402: Using Hibernate built-in connection pool (not for production use!)

      Mar 13, 2012 11:27:54 PM org.hibernate.service.jdbc.connections.internal.DriverManagerConnectionProviderImpl configure

      INFO: HHH000115: Hibernate connection pool size: 20

      Mar 13, 2012 11:27:54 PM org.hibernate.service.jdbc.connections.internal.DriverManagerConnectionProviderImpl configure

      INFO: HHH000006: Autocommit mode: false

      Mar 13, 2012 11:27:54 PM org.hibernate.service.jdbc.connections.internal.DriverManagerConnectionProviderImpl configure

      INFO: HHH000401: using driver [com.mysql.jdbc.Driver] at URL [jdbc:mysql://localhost/gowidata]

      Mar 13, 2012 11:27:54 PM org.hibernate.service.jdbc.connections.internal.DriverManagerConnectionProviderImpl configure

      INFO: HHH000046: Connection properties: {user=desarrollo, password=****}

      Mar 13, 2012 11:27:55 PM org.hibernate.dialect.Dialect <init>

      INFO: HHH000400: Using dialect: org.hibernate.dialect.MySQLDialect

      Mar 13, 2012 11:27:55 PM org.hibernate.engine.transaction.internal.TransactionFactoryInitiator initiateService

      INFO: HHH000399: Using default transaction strategy (direct JDBC transactions)

      Mar 13, 2012 11:27:55 PM org.hibernate.hql.internal.ast.ASTQueryTranslatorFactory <init>

      INFO: HHH000397: Using ASTQueryTranslatorFactory

      Initial SessionFactory creation failed.org.hibernate.HibernateException: Error applying BeanValidation relational constraints

      Exception in thread "main" java.lang.ExceptionInInitializerError

         at gowiico.utilidades.HibernateUtil.buildSessionFactory(HibernateUtil.java:24)

         at gowiico.utilidades.HibernateUtil.<clinit>(HibernateUtil.java:14)

         at gowiico.test.BdTest.main(BdTest.java:22)

      Caused by: org.hibernate.HibernateException: Error applying BeanValidation relational constraints

         at org.hibernate.cfg.beanvalidation.BeanValidationIntegrator.applyRelationalConstraints(BeanValidationIntegrator.java:219)

         at org.hibernate.cfg.beanvalidation.BeanValidationIntegrator.integrate(BeanValidationIntegrator.java:126)

         at org.hibernate.internal.SessionFactoryImpl.<init>(SessionFactoryImpl.java:304)

         at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1740)

         at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1778)

         at gowiico.utilidades.HibernateUtil.buildSessionFactory(HibernateUtil.java:19)

         ... 2 more

      Caused by: java.lang.reflect.InvocationTargetException

         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

         at java.lang.reflect.Method.invoke(Method.java:597)

         at org.hibernate.cfg.beanvalidation.BeanValidationIntegrator.applyRelationalConstraints(BeanValidationIntegrator.java:208)

         ... 7 more

      Caused by: java.lang.NoClassDefFoundError: org/slf4j/LoggerFactory

         at org.hibernate.validator.util.LoggerFactory.make(LoggerFactory.java:29)

         at org.hibernate.validator.util.Version.<clinit>(Version.java:24)

         at org.hibernate.validator.engine.ConfigurationImpl.<clinit>(ConfigurationImpl.java:59)

         at org.hibernate.validator.HibernateValidator.createGenericConfiguration(HibernateValidator.java:41)

         at javax.validation.Validation$GenericBootstrapImpl.configure(Validation.java:269)

         at javax.validation.Validation.buildDefaultValidatorFactory(Validation.java:111)

         at org.hibernate.cfg.beanvalidation.TypeSafeActivator.getValidatorFactory(TypeSafeActivator.java:521)

         at org.hibernate.cfg.beanvalidation.TypeSafeActivator.applyDDL(TypeSafeActivator.java:119)

         ... 12 more

      Caused by: java.lang.ClassNotFoundException: org.slf4j.LoggerFactory

         at java.net.URLClassLoader$1.run(URLClassLoader.java:202)

         at java.security.AccessController.doPrivileged(Native Method)

         at java.net.URLClassLoader.findClass(URLClassLoader.java:190)

         at java.lang.ClassLoader.loadClass(ClassLoader.java:306)

         at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:301)

         at java.lang.ClassLoader.loadClass(ClassLoader.java:247)

         ... 20 more